Subject: Re: [PATCH] riscv: Fix udelay in RV32.

On Tue, May 28, 2019 at 05:26:49PM +0800, Nick Hu wrote:
> In RV32, udelay would delay the wrong cycle.
> When it shifts right "UDELAY_SHITFT" bits, it
> either delays 0 cycle or 1 cycle. It only works
> correctly in RV64. Because the 'ucycles' always
> needs to be 64 bits variable.

Please use up all your ~72 chars per line in the commit log.

> diff --git a/arch/riscv/lib/delay.c b/arch/riscv/lib/delay.c
> index dce8ae24c6d3..da847f49fb74 100644
> --- a/arch/riscv/lib/delay.c
> +++ b/arch/riscv/lib/delay.c
> @@ -88,7 +88,7 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L(__delay);
>  
>  void udelay(unsigned long usecs)
>  {
> -	unsigned long ucycles = usecs * lpj_fine * UDELAY_MULT;
> +	unsigned long long ucycles = (unsigned long long)usecs * lpj_fine * UDELAY_MULT;

And this creates a way too long line.  Pleaase use u64 instead of
unsigned long long to clarify the intention while also fixing the long
lines.
